What is a remote developer?

Remote developers are software professionals who work from locations outside of a traditional office environment, often from home or co-working spaces. They use digital tools to collaborate with team members and clients, writing code, fixing bugs, and participating in project meetings online. Remote developers enjoy flexibility in their work location and hours, but they also need strong communication skills and self-motivation. This role is popular in the tech industry, enabling companies to access talent from around the world.

What does a remote developer do?

Remote developers, or remote software developers, design and create computer software programs and applications for their employer or client. Unlike in-house developers, remote developers work from home or another location outside of the office. As a remote developer, you discuss the kind of program you need to create, making sure to clarify with your department or with your client what they need in their application. You may develop an entirely new program or improve an existing one. Remote developers are responsible for a program’s overall function, and they design precise workflow charts that explain to programmers what code is needed for different aspects of the program. Remote developers may also design tests and protocols for the QA department to follow when they are testing the application.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Developer, you need strong programming skills, problem-solving abilities, and experience with software development methodologies, often supported by a relevant degree or coding certifications.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, remote collaboration tools (e.g., Slack, Jira), and cloud-based development environments is typically required. Excellent self-motivation, time management, and clear written communication set standout remote developers apart. These skills and qualities are crucial for delivering high-quality code, collaborating effectively across distributed teams, and maintaining productivity independently.

What are some common challenges faced by remote developers, and how can they be managed effectively?

Remote developers often encounter challenges such as communication barriers, feelings of isolation, and managing work-life balance due to the lack of physical boundaries between home and work. To overcome these, it's important to establish clear communication channels with your team, set regular check-ins, and use collaboration tools effectively. Additionally, creating a dedicated workspace and setting defined work hours can help maintain productivity and personal well-being. Many companies also support remote developers through virtual team-building activities and flexible schedules.

INFICON is a leading provider of innovative instrumentation, critical sensor technologies, and Smart Manufacturing/Industry 4.0 software solutions that enhance productivity and quality of tools, processes, and complete factories. These analysis, measurement and control products are essential for gas leak detection in air conditioning/refrigeration and automotive manufacturing. They are vital to equipment manufacturers and end-users in the complex fabrication of semiconductors and thin film coatings for optics, flat panel displays, solar cells and industrial vacuum coating applications. Other users of our vacuum-based processes include the life sciences, research, aerospace, packaging, heat treatment, laser cutting and many other industrial processes. We also leverage our expertise in vacuum technology to provide unique, toxic chemical analysis products for emergency response, security, and environmental health and safety.
